摘要
The structural flexibility at three substitution sites in LaFeAsO enabled investigation of the relation between superconductivity and structural parameters over a wide range of crystal compositions. Substitutions of Nd for La, Sb or P for As, and F or H for O were performed. All these substitutions modify the local structural parameters, while the F/H-substitution also changes band filling. It was found that the superconducting transition temperature Tc is strongly affected by the pnictogen height hPn from the Fe-plane that controls the electron correlation strength and the size of the dxy hole Fermi surface (FS). With increasing hPn, weak coupling BCS superconductivity switches to the strong coupling non-BCS one where electron correlations and the dxy hole FS may be important.
